Ticket LV-2241: Vault lockout — Dispatchette simulator credentials

The secrets vault holding the Dispatchette elevator-dispatch simulator's license keys auto-locked after three failed unseal attempts. Simulation runs for the Harrowgate tower project are blocked. Security review needed before unseal. Procedure: verify requester against the custodian roster, confirm no tamper alerts on the vault audit log, then unseal with the standing recovery passphrase. Passphrase on record below.

vault phrase of taweg-kafof = oliax-zorael

Briefing: Loyalty Overhaul — Kestrel Rewards

For the incoming director. Kestrel Rewards is being rebuilt: points expiry scrapped, tiers cut from five to three, redemption moved in-app. Pilot in the Darnfield region showed 12% lift in repeat visits. Vendor contract with Lumehart Systems signs next month. Budget holds at prior-year levels. Full rollout targeted for Q3. The note below summarises the commercial rationale not yet shared outside leadership.

internal memo for tajep-haduf: Headcount on the Oliath team goes from 18 to 94 by the end of March. Gross margin on Oliath came in at 39 percent against a plan of 13 percent.

Handover — Commission Scheme. Welcome aboard, Priya. Quick steer on the Hallowmere commission revamp: tiers are agreed, accelerators above quota are not. Sales leads are pushing hard; finance wants caps. The steering group meets fortnightly — worth attending in person. Draft comms are in the shared folder. The confidential background you'll need is noted just below.

internal memo for kawip-hadug: Headcount on the Wenwyn team goes from 7 to 140 by the end of January. Gross margin on Wenwyn came in at 20 percent against a plan of 15 percent.